## ParcelPing webhook — basics

ParcelPing receives carrier status events and fans them out to subscriber endpoints. Delivery retries use exponential backoff, max five attempts, then the event lands in the dead-letter queue. Check the DLQ before blaming a carrier. Signature verification is mandatory; never disable it in production, even for debugging. Replay tooling lives in the ops repo. The webhook service starts with these configuration values.

deployment values, yadug-bawif:
[framir]
team = pelox
access_code = ac_a38ab2
owner = tamion.julael
host = framir.tolvaqlabs.test
port = 11211
peer = tammir.zemvargrid.local
salt = 2215ef03
pin = 1541

**Mgmt Meeting Minutes — Retiring the Brightline Range**

Quick recap for sales leads at Fenholt Supplies: we agreed to retire the Brightline fixture range by year-end. Remaining stock moves to clearance pricing next month, and accounts on standing orders get migrated to the Lumetta range. Trade-in incentives were approved in principle. The confidential note on next steps sits just below.

board note of bajof-bajeg: The pricing group signed off on a budget of $13.4 million for Project Sildor. The renewal with Lamixek Holdings closes at $48.9 million a year, 49 percent above the last contract.

## Ownership

Heads up for the security review: the Tallow Payroll export format changed in v5 from fixed-width text to signed JSON bundles. The old format is still emitted for two legacy integrations (flagged in config), so both code paths are live and both need scrutiny. Key rotation for the signing step happens quarterly. Nothing in the new format carries plaintext bank fields — that's the whole point. For provenance questions, threat-model docs, or a walkthrough of the signing pipeline, ask the format owner, named below.

account owner for bawip-tahag: Raleth Quenok